Let's start with the basics. If you're encountering issues, the first port of call is often password management. McKinsey's system has specific requirements for password resets to ensure security. Think at least 12 characters, a mix of letters and numbers, no three consecutive identical characters, and crucially, it shouldn't match your username or email. If you've tried this and are still stuck, reaching out for direct assistance is the next logical step; they can reset it for you. Now, for those using Single Sign-On (SSO), the password reset function won't apply. Instead, you'll select the dedicated SSO button on the login page and use your company credentials. It's a streamlined approach, but it means the usual 'forgot password' route isn't the path to take here.
Getting a 'wrong credentials' error? This is a classic sign to try the 'Forgot your password?' link. A password reset email should land in your inbox, guiding you through the steps. It’s a common hiccup, and the system is designed to help you through it.
Ever wondered why you suddenly find yourself logged out? For your privacy and security, the system has a built-in timeout. After 30 minutes of inactivity, it logs you out automatically. It’s a small measure, but it adds a layer of protection to your session.

Beyond the core login, there are other considerations. For instance, if you're trying to access mckinsey.com and run into trouble, it might be as simple as your browser's cookies being disabled. Enabling them is usually a straightforward process, often found in your browser's settings or documentation. When you're looking at specific platforms like 'My Benefits,' the login experience can vary slightly. For McKinsey Firm Members and MIO Members, SSO is the way to go. However, if you're an invited family member, retiree, advisor, or prospective hire, you'll use a separate login form, and importantly, you shouldn't use your firm email, username, or password here.
